1 Therefore putting off all malice and all guile and hypocrisy and envy and all slander,
2 as a newborn infant you must yearn for the pure rational milk, in order that by it you would grow into preservation,
3 if "you taste that the Prince is benevolent".
4 Coming forth to Him a living stone, indeed having been rejected as unfit by men but honored elect before Yahweh,
5 and yourselves as living stones are built a spiritual house for a holy priesthood to offer spiritual sacrifices acceptable to Yahweh through Yahshua Christ.
6 Wherefore it is contained in the Scripture: "Behold, I place in Zion an honored elect corner stone, and he believing in Him shall by no means be ashamed."
7 Therefore the honor for you is for those who believe, but they who do not believe: "The stone which the builders have rejected, this has come to be for the head cornerstone"
8 and "a stumbling stone and a rock of offense." They stumble disobeying the Word, for which also they have been ordained.
9 But you are an elect race, a royal priesthood, a holy nation, a peculiar people, so that you should proclaim the virtues for which from out of darkness you have been called into the wonder of His light,
10 who at one time were "not a people" but now are the people of Yahweh, those who "have not been shown mercy" but are now shown mercy.
11 Beloved, I exhort as emigrants and sojourners that you abstain from fleshly desires which make war against the soul,
12 holding your conduct well among the heathens, in order that while they slander you as evil-doers, watching from the good works they may honor Yahweh on the day of visitation.
13 You must be obedient to every authority created by mankind on account of the Prince, whether to kings as if being superior,
14 or to governors as if being sent by Him for the punishment of evil-doers but for the praise of those doing good.
15 Because thusly is the will of Yahweh: doing good to muzzle the ignorance of foolish men,
16 as free men yet not as if having freedom for a cover for evil, but as servants of Yahweh.
17 You must honor all, love the brotherhood, fear Yahweh, honor the King.
18 Servants, subject yourselves with all fear to the masters, not only to the good and reasonable but also to the crooked.
19 For this is a benefit, if through consciousness of Yahweh one endures suffering grief unrighteously.
20 For what sort of report, if doing wrong and being beaten you will submit? But if doing good and suffering you submit, this is a benefit before Yahweh.
21 Indeed, for this you have been called, because Christ also had suffered on your behalf, leaving behind for you an example in order that you would follow in His footsteps,
22 who had not committed wrong nor had guile been found in His mouth,
23 who being abused had not abused in return, suffering had not made threats, but surrendered to Him judging righteously.
24 Who Himself carried your errors on His body upon the cross, that the errors being taken away we should live in righteousness; by whose wounds you are healed.
25 For you were as sheep wandering astray, but you must return now to the Shepherd and Overseer of your souls!
